The Executive Development Programme in Water Conservation Impact Assessment and Reporting is a certificate course designed to empower professionals with the necessary skills to address pressing water conservation challenges. This program is critical due to increasing water scarcity, climate change, and stringent environmental regulations.

This course is in high demand across various industries, including manufacturing, agriculture, and environmental consulting, as organizations strive to minimize their water footprint and ensure sustainable growth. By enrolling in this program, learners will develop a deep understanding of water conservation principles, impact assessment techniques, and reporting methodologies. Upon completion, learners will be equipped with essential skills to evaluate water conservation initiatives, communicate findings effectively, and drive strategic decision-making in their organizations. This course not only enhances professional expertise but also paves the way for career advancement in a world striving for sustainable development.

Kursdetails

โ€ข Introduction to Water Conservation Impact Assessment
โ€ข Understanding Water Scarcity and Its Impact
โ€ข Legal and Regulatory Framework for Water Conservation
โ€ข Tools and Techniques for Water Conservation Impact Assessment
โ€ข Stakeholder Engagement and Communication in Water Conservation
โ€ข Data Collection and Analysis for Water Conservation Reporting
โ€ข Best Practices in Water Conservation Reporting
โ€ข Using Technology for Water Conservation Impact Assessment and Reporting
โ€ข Case Studies in Water Conservation Impact Assessment and Reporting
โ€ข Developing a Water Conservation Action Plan
